Conception de l’Architecture Logicielle

9 professional roles

Architecte de Cohérence des Systèmes Distribués
Naviguez à travers le théorème CAP, la cohérence éventuelle, les transactions distribuées et les protocoles de consensus pour concevoir des systèmes distribués fiables avec les garanties de cohérence appropriées.
Architecte de Solutions Cloud-Natif
Architecturer des applications cloud-natives sur AWS, GCP ou Azure en utilisant des conteneurs, du serverless, des services managés et des modèles de conception cloud modernes pour l'évolutivité et la résilience.
Architecte des Attributs de Qualité Logicielle
Concevoir des architectures qui satisfont aux exigences non fonctionnelles telles que la scalabilité, la disponibilité, la sécurité, la maintenabilité et la performance grâce à des tactiques architecturales éprouvées et une analyse des compromis.
Architecte Domain-Driven Design
Appliquez le Domain-Driven Design pour modéliser des domaines métier complexes à l'aide de bounded contexts, aggregates, domain events et langage ubiquitaire, afin de produire un logiciel maintenable et expressif.
Architecte Microservices
Concevez des architectures de microservices évolutives avec des conseils d'experts sur la décomposition des services, la communication inter-services et les modèles de systèmes distribués.
Concepteur d'API Gateway et Backend-for-Frontend
Concevoir des architectures de passerelle API et des couches Backend-for-Frontend (BFF) qui optimisent la communication client-serveur pour les intégrations web, mobiles et tierces.
Concepteur d'Architecture Serverless
Concevez des architectures serverless rentables en utilisant AWS Lambda, Azure Functions et Google Cloud Run avec des conseils d'experts sur les limites des fonctions, les démarrages à froid et les déclencheurs d'événements.
Planificateur de Migration Monolithe vers Microservices
Planifiez des migrations sûres et incrémentales d'applications monolithiques vers des microservices en utilisant des modèles éprouvés comme Strangler Fig, les couches anti-corruption et des stratégies de décomposition par phases.
Spécialiste en Documentation d'Architecture Logicielle
Créez une documentation d'architecture professionnelle à l'aide de diagrammes du modèle C4, de registres de décisions d'architecture, de modèles arc42 et de processus RFC qui communiquent clairement la conception à toutes les parties prenantes.